Just thought I would mention something on here:
Today MAN-HKG became available on 28th. Unfortunately MAN-(HKG)-BKK was only showing available for waitlist. HKG-BKK was still showing as 57,000 business tailored only. I called CX to ask if I could confirm MAN-HKG with HKG-BKK as waitlist and she said MAN-BKK is not available if she searches for it however if she searched as MAN-HKG-BKK it gave lots of availability all at the normal choice level. I managed to ticket MAN-HKG-BKK for the normal 65,000 miles. I could find no-way to do this online and if she hadn't have mentioned it I would have never known.
So seems they can get different connecting availability if you go through the telephone office!
